We love a good time lapse and this one doesn’t disappoint. Go behind the scenes on this ambitious photoshoot for Pedrali.
May 2nd, 2013
We’re constantly in awe of the new and enterprising lengths taken in communicating a new design or presenting a fresh a campaign. This behind the scenes look at one of Pedrali’s aerial shoots to mark the company’s 50th Birthday celebrations is no exception.
